Abstract

Die automatische Gussputzschleifmaschine mit einem, gegenein­ ander und gemeinsam verstellbare Festspannmittel (5,6) für ein zu bearbeitendes Gusswerkstück (1) tragenden Maschinen­ ständer (10) und mit einem, eine Schleif- und/oder Trennschei­ be (2) tragenden Werkzeughalter (3), der über Schlittenmittel (4) an das Gusswerkstück (1) anstellbar auf einem Maschinen­ bock (11) abgestützt ist, gestattet eine berührungslose, präzise Erzeugung eines Steuersignals dadurch, dass die Festspann­ mittel (5,6) gegen den Maschinenständer (10) über Isolations­ mittel (12) und die Schleif- und/oder Trennscheibe (2) gegen den Werkzeughalter (3) über Isolationsmittel (13) elektrisch isoliert sind; dass die Schleif- und/oder Trennscheibe (2) elektrisch leitend ausgebildet ist; und dass die Schleif- und/oder Trennscheibe (2) und die Festspannmittel (5,6) resp. das zwischen diesen eingespannte Gusswerkstück (1) mit einem regelbaren Hochspannungsgenerator (20) und einer, ein Steuer­ signal (22) liefernden Zündstrom- Auswertschaltung (21) in Serie geschaltet sind.
